How to Find a Patient Record (3 of 6)
< Back

Browsing all Patients allows you to visually search the entire list of established patient records in your PreViser data file, then select the record you wish to view.

1. From the Home page menu, click Browse all Patients. This displays the summary list of your patients, shown below:

2. Hovering your mouse over a row highlights it in a different color (orange). Clicking on that row opens that patient's record.

3. Patients are listed alphabetically by last name. (You can also sort the list by clicking on a column heading, to alphabetize the city names, for example.) Since you are looking for Demo_Joe Demo_Thompson, scroll down the list to the D names, where you will see his name. Click on that row to display DemoJoe’s full record on the Patient Details screen, shown below:
